WWW.POLYGON.COMThe best movies leaving Netflix, Max, and Prime at the end of August 2024Were almost to the end of the month, and that means a lot of coming and going on every major streaming platform. And while plenty of exciting movies are on the way in September, were here to make sure you dont miss the gems leaving at the end of August.To help you close out summer with the best movies possible, weve put together a list of the very best movies leaving streaming services at the end of the month, including a unique coming-of-age movie, two dark fantasy trips, and two vibes masterpieces from the great Michael Mann.Here are the best movies leaving streaming at the end of August.Editors pick: The Edge of SeventeenDirector: Kelly Fremon CraigCast: Hailee Steinfeld, Haley Lu Richardson, Blake JennerLeaving Netflix: Aug. 31Teenagers arent all movies make them out to be. Sure, they have their moments of pluckiness or compassionate understanding, and most will turn out all right in a few years, but theres a lot of selfishness to get through first. And very few movies have ever portrayed that selfishness as well as The Edge of Seventeen.The movie follows Nadine (Hailee Steinfeld), a young girl struggling through life with her brother (Blake Jenner) and mom (Kyra Sedgwick) after the unexpected death of her dad. In her grief, Nadine is mean, angry, and seemingly blind to the grief of everyone around her, all problems that only get worse when her best friend (Haley Lu Richardson) starts dating her brother.All of this may sound like a bit of a drag, but among the movies many strengths is how wonderfully funny it manages to stay from front to back. This is thanks in large part to Steinfelds incredible performance, which walks a perfect line, constantly keeping Nadine thoroughly mean and undeniably charming. Its the rare movie where you spend the whole time not rooting for the main character to succeed but for her to realize that she is being a jerk. There arent enough movies like this, about likable characters who are totally wrong, but thats probably because its not nearly as easy as The Edge of Seventeen makes it look. Austen GoslinMovies leaving Prime VideoBram Stokers DraculaDirector: Francis Ford CoppolaCast: Gary Oldman, Keanu Reeves, Winona RyderLeaving Prime Video: Aug. 31When you think of actors who exude the unearthly sex appeal and monstrous inclination one would expect from the iconic Count Dracula, Gary Oldman isnt exactly the first name that would leap to most folks minds. Thats what makes his performance in Francis Ford Coppolas 1992 horror fantasy so remarkable, as Oldmans out-of-character portrayal of the sullen, blood-sucking libertine opposite Keanu Reeves performance as the heroic Jonathan Harker makes for one of the most memorable incarnations of the Count to ever be put on screen.Combined with the films gorgeous practical set designs, elaborate costumes courtesy of designer Eiko Ishioka, and some notable supporting performances by Anthony Hopkins and Tom Waits, Bram Stokers Dracula is one of the most unique films in Coppolas highly celebrated body of work. And with Megalopolis around the corner, the time is right to revisit one of his classics. Toussaint EganMovies leaving NetflixMiami ViceDirector: Michael MannCast: Colin Farrell, Jamie Foxx, Naomie HarrisLeaving Netflix: Aug. 31Michael Mann has made a number of certified cinematic bangers across his long and illustrious career, like his 1995 symphonic crime drama Heat, one of my all-time favorite movies. But no other film in his oeuvre is more quintessentially Mann-core than Miami Vice, the feature-length adaptation of the 1984 crime drama series Mann produced that starred Don Johnson and Philip Michael Thomas.The plot couldnt be any further from the point. Heres the real heart of Miami Vices enduring appeal: It simply doesnt look or feel like any other crime drama of its era. Manns experiment with digital photography yields a level of uncanny realism through its landscape of crushed brown and black textures and bleached white beach vistas. Its a crime drama that oozes a sense of cool entirely on its own terms, a grand experiment that has yielded a cult following and reappraisal as one of the directors best. In short, Miami Vice is a vibe. TEMovies leaving MaxThe Green KnightDirector: David LoweryCast: Dev Patel, Alicia Vikander, Ralph InesonLeaving Max: Aug. 31The Green Knight is one of the most beautiful movies of the last decade. Director David Lowerys film retells the poem Sir Gawain and the Green Knight, in which the knight Sir Gawain (Dev Patel) decapitates a mysterious Green Knight (Ralph Ineson) and travels to receive an equal blow one year later. While Lowerys film technically tells the whole story, its main focus is the odd events that befall Gawain in his travels to the Green Chapel.Watching this movie feels like being trapped in a dream, a flood of gorgeous images loosely connected by an outstanding performance from Patel as the neer-do-well knight who isnt sure whether hes on a march to the gallows. In each progressively more strange scene, Patel sells Gawains wonderful incredulousness, somehow simultaneously rooted in the weirdness of his present moment, and drifting mentally to his appointment with a deity that might wish him dead. Its bizarre, poetic, and tremendously affecting in ways that make it a more than worthy adaptation of the classic Arthurian tale. AGMovies leaving Criterion ChannelThiefDirector: Michael MannCast: James Caan, Willie Nelson, Tuesday WeldLeaving Criterion Channel: Aug. 31The late, great James Caan (The Godfather) stars in Michael Manns 1981 neo-noir heist thriller Thief as Frank, an ex-con and professional safecracker looking to go straight and start a family. Unfortunately for him, Frank is denied his share of his latest heist, forcing him to accept an assignment from the Mob in order to break even. With a beautiful synth score by Tangerine Dream, dazzling nighttime cinematography by Donald Thorin, and an iconic and emotionally nuanced performance by Caan, Thief is a stone-cold stunner and a gem in the crown of one of the finest directors working today. DESIGN-MILK.COMThe Riviera Maya EDITION at Kanai Debuts Relaxed LuxuryTo many, Cancun may conjure images of raucous spring break parties and throngs of tourists seeking all-inclusive resorts along a bustling hotel zone. However, the Riviera Maya region, of which Cancun is a part, holds a hidden gem that defies these preconceptions. Nestled within an expansive nature preserve, the Riviera Maya EDITION at Kanai made its debut as a refined and sustainable addition to the Caribbean coastline, introducing a fresh approach to relaxed luxury, honoring both the environment and cultural heritage of the Yucatan Peninsula.With interiors crafted by Ian Schrager Company in collaboration with the acclaimed Rockwell Group, and architecture by Edmonds International, the three main buildings that make up the Riviera Maya EDITION at Kanai converge in the architectural equivalent of a cenote. The design of the resort emphasizes minimal environmental impact, preserving the regions natural beauty, from the vibrant flora and fauna to the nearby Mesoamerican Reef, the worlds second-largest coral reef. The property is surrounded by rich local biodiversity, featuring tropical fruit trees, flowering plants, and wildlife including iguanas, spider monkeys, and sea turtles.Guests arriving at the property are guided through a three-mile road lined with mangroves, gradually transitioning into the secluded world of the resort. The timber-clad exteriors blend seamlessly with the surrounding forest, and upon entering, visitors are greeted with expansive views of the ocean framed by reflecting pools. This visual narrative continues throughout the property, where water elements and architectural details evoke the natural landscape.The resort offers 182 guest rooms, including 30 suites, many of which feature private plunge pools and terraces with views of the ocean or mangroves. The interiors reflect the classic EDITION aesthetic of neutral palettes and regional influences, with materials and textures that honor the local culture. A standout is the Sky Rooftop Villa, North Americas largest hotel penthouse, boasting 27,000 square feet of space, an infinity pool, and expansive ocean views. The resort also features The Spa, designed to reflect the cenote-inspired architecture, offering hydrotherapy pools, a Turkish hammam, and wellness treatments that draw on local botanicals.Photography courtesy of EDITION hotels.0 Kommentare 0 Anteile 230 Ansichten

UXDESIGN.CC8 Figma tips for UI3Figmas new UI3 brings change, but also brings new tools to tryout.Since Figmas Config back in June, I anxiously waited to get beta-access to the new UI3. I immediately wanted to adjust to the new symbols, layout, and tool placement. Not to mention, it was forewarned that all users will eventually have to useUI3.But I wasnt aware that the UI3 was being slowlyyy rolled out to Figma users*. I expected to begin using it immediately after Configs keynote, but I had to wait well over amonth.*Note: Teammates on the same Figma plan may get access before you do. I became confused when one of my peers was sharing their screen to show work in Figma, and I could see they had the UI3. After a Figma forum search, I was disappointed to see I was at the mercy of whoever grants early access to theUI.So if you still dont have access to the UI3, save this article and keep being patient (maybe pray to the Figma UI3 lords). Once you do finally have access, play around in the new UI, then come back to thisarticle.Now, lets dive into these 8 tips to be equipped to use FigmasUI3.Table ofcontentsSwap back to the previousUISelect matching layers & bulk-edit textUse suggested auto-layoutUse follow prototypeHide hints on click for prototypesFix auto-layout withoverlaysUse annotations inDev-modePin files to projects and workspaces1. Swap back to the previousUII know this tip may seem to defeat the purpose, but a re-design can be difficult to get used to. If you just got access to the UI3 and have many design deliverables due, you may not have time to learn the new UI quiteyet.Steps:1aSelect the Help and resources question-mark icon in the bottom-right of theUI1bFrom the menu, select Go back to previousUIHelp and resources inFigma1cOnce ready for the UI3, open the Help and resources menu Select Use newUI^Go to table ofcontents2. Select matching layers & bulk-edit textThe placement and functionality of these tools has changed from the previous UI to UI3. Since UI3 doesnt include the dynamic tool-bar* at the top-center of the canvas, the select matching layers tool was moved to the Actions item in the bottommenu.The bulk-edit text tools functionality was merged with the select matching layers tool. Once youve selected text layers manually or from using the select matching layers tool, you can simply type to update all text layers atonce.Steps:2aSelect layers in the file Select Actions in the menu Select matching layers (or use Option+Command+A)2bMake updates to the layers (color-change, swap components, etc.)2cIf updating text layers, select Enter or Return Make texteditsSelect matching layers tool in the menu ofFigma*On a side note: I loved the dynamic tool-bar at the top of the UI (RIP). The toolbar updated depending on what I was doing in the canvas. So Im bummed by this change, but they may continue to make improvements as they receive more feedback from the UI3beta.^Go to table ofcontents3. Use suggested auto-layoutThis tool brings value for both new and advanced Figma users. Auto-layout is Figmas most difficult concept to understand, and its tedious to carry out. Suggested auto-layout can do it for you (and quitewell)*.Steps:3aSelect the elements for the frame Right-click to open the tool menu Select More layout options Select Suggest auto-layout (or Control+Shift+A)Apply suggested auto-layout to create aframe3bCheck the frames (ensure hugging and filling arecorrect)3cAdjust padding and spacing in parent and childframes3dRename the frame layers manually or by using Figma AIs rename layers (maybe Figma will integrate the rename layers tools here in thefuture)Suggested auto-layouts output*Note: This tool cannot support complex frames yet. Figma recommends you use this tool in batches for many child-parent frames.^Go to table ofcontents4. Use follow prototypeWhen you create a prototype, bugs can happen. Maybe the overlay didnt correctly pop-up or the hover effect didnt work. It can be difficult to pin-point the exact location of the bug as you check the prototypeespecially if the prototype iscomplex.When previewing a prototype, the follow prototype tool allows you to keep track of which frame youre viewing on the prototype. So when you find a bug, youll know where itis!Steps:4aSelect the preview button for the prototypes starting point (or Shift+Space)Select Preview on the prototypes startingpoint4bSelect the overflow menu in the preview windows toolbar Select Follow prototype (if unchecked)Select Follow prototype from the windowstoolbar4cTest the prototype (you can still select R torestart)Follow prototype used in preview-mode^Go to table ofcontents5. Hide hints on click for prototypesIf you conduct usability tests on UserTesting.com or similar tools, you may encounter participants who click to see the blue highlights to find the prototypes interactions. Well, this defeats the purpose of a usability test.Next time you conduct any research with Figma prototypes, hide the hints on click so participants can no longer cheat and find the interactions.Steps:5aSelect the play button at a prototypes starting point (or Option+Command+Enter)5bSelect the overflow menu in the top-bar of the prototype Unselect Show hints on click (ifchecked)Unselect Show hints on click in play-mode^Go to table ofcontents6. Fix auto-layout withoverlaysWhen you have a component with an overlay, like a dropdown (or select), you dont want it to push other content in the frame down, and you dont want the overlay to appear behind otherlayers.Issues when including an overlay in auto-layoutMy old fix for this issue was to absolute-position the overlay (now called ignore auto-layout). But Ive found a new solutionadjust the frames canvas-stacking to be first ontop.Steps:6aMake sure the components height doesnt include the overlay (for a dropdown, only the input field should be included)6bInsert the component into the targetframe6cSelect the parent frame of the component Select Auto-layout settings in the design panel Select First ontopFirst on top canvas stacking helps show overlays when using auto-layout6dRepeat step 6c if there are multiple parent frames impacting theoverlay^Go to table ofcontents7. Use annotations inDev-modeThough Dev-mode has been around for some time, Im still acclimating to its features and beginning to use it more. One feature thats very useful is the Annotate tool. With this tool, you can add special notes and pin properties like height, font size, color,etc.Steps:7aSwap to Dev-mode using the tool-bar (orShift+D)7bSelect the Annotate tool from the tool-bar (orShift+T)7cSelect an element in the design to annotate Type in the field to create anoteUse the Annotate tool inDev-mode7dIf needed, select +Property Pin properties to theelement7eTo remove annotations in Dev-mode, right-click on the frame Select Remove annotationsHere is what a finished annotation looks like in Dev-mode:Finished annotations to a design inDev-mode^Go to table ofcontents8. Pin files to projects and workspacesFiles can be difficult to find in Figmafor designers, engineers, and stakeholders. For important files, like Dev-ready designs, you can pin them to projects and workspaces to make them more findable. This way, you dont have to send the same Figma file link to the same person 5timesSteps:8aGo to a workspaces team Select a project to view its files (preferably one you have edit-access to)8bRight-click on a file Select Pin to project or Pin to workspace (the file will be shown in 2 places: the file list and pinnedlist)Pin a file to the project or to the workspaceHere is what the pinned file looks like on the project-level:Pinned file on the project-levelHere is what the pinned file looks like on the workspace-level:Pinned file on the workspace-level8cTo remove the pinned project, right-click on the file in either the file list or pinned list Select Remove project pin or Remove workspace pin^Go to table ofcontentsThats all for now,folks!You may have noticed, I didnt mention tips for the notorious Figma AI. WWW.ENGADGET.COMThreads is testing disappearing posts that expire after 24 hoursThreads is testing the option for users to put a 24-hour expiration timer on their posts, after which the post and all replies would disappear, Stories-style. A spokesperson confirmed to TechCrunch that the feature is being tested among a group of users after it was first spotted earlier this summer by developer Alessandro Paluzzi. It sounds a lot like pre-X Twitters Fleets, which didnt exactly catch on. But, the ephemeral format could save habitual post-deleters some trouble.It comes a few months after Instagram head Adam Mosseri shared that Threads was experimenting with auto-archiving. That optional feature would let users designate a date for their posts to be hidden from the feed. But Threads users in the past have indicated that they largely arent into the idea of automatic archiving, and such a feature hasnt yet shown up on a wider scale. Threads hit the 200 million user mark at the beginning of August, and recently introduced an analytics tool called Insights for users particularly those with large followings to keep track of their accounts performance.
